Hot topics on our agenda include:

  • Network with other wearable stakeholders to build a wearable tech community and discover what the future of wearables will look like
  • Novelty Vs Authenticity – Discover how a device with high levels of authenticity will result in continuous engagement and persistent use by customers with Catapult
  • Wearables in Enterprise – Explore the unique ability of wearable devices to improve enterprise efficiency and safety with Google
  • Medically Accepted Wearable Devices – Hear from Vital Connect Europe and discover how they have successfully created a medically accepted and regulated wearable device
  • Consumer Adoption – Discover methods to increase consumer adoption for your device in this fragmented marketplace with Misfit
  • Wearable Business Models – Develop a business model specific to your wearable device and differentiate yourself in this crowded ecosystem
  • Quantified Self to Functional Self - A case study from Interaxon exploring the importance of analysing your data to provide functional information and meaningful insights
  • Fashion and Functionality – Determine how to blur the lines between fashionable and functional in order to achieve mainstream success with Kiroco
